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- •Chronic stage of stroke (time of injury over 6 months);
- •Hemiparesis; unilateral brain lesion and non\-recurring, mild to moderate spasticity, with level 1 or 2 of the modified Ashworth scale;
- •Ability to ambulate functionally, with some assistance or personal with the use of assistive devices for walking, levels 4 and 5 of the protocol Functional Ambulation Category \- FAC;
- •Idling (slower than 0\.4 m / s) or moderate (speed from 0\.4 to 0\.8 m / s) according to the classification of gait based on speed;
- •Absence of cognitive impairment, from the score of the Mini Mental State Examination (MMSE);
- •Absence of other neurological or orthopedic pathologies that lead to functional sequelae than those brought by stroke or disability visual and/or hearing loss that adversely affects the training of biofeedback.
Exclusion Criteria
- •Instability in the cardiovascular condition during training;
- •Lack of understanding of instructions for carrying out training
